Etymology of Barleria:
For Jacques Barrelier (1606-1673), French Dominican monk, biologist, botanist and physician.
Etymology of merxmuelleri:
Named after Herman Merxmuller, born 1920 in Munchen. Visited South West Africa five times and edited the Prodomus of the flora of SWA.
